| Features and Description |
 |
A smart video accelerator for SDTV video encoding
and decoding, with MIPI and SMIA camera interfaces. |
 |
A smart audio accelerator containing a comprehensive
set of digital audio decoders and encoders, and offering
a large number of 3-D surround effects. |
 |
A smart imaging accelerator, providing real-time,
programmable image reconstruction engine. |
 |
A smart graphics accelerator. |
 |
A dynamic, multi-mode power management unit. |
 |
The ARM926EJ processor, a powerful industry-standard
CPU with Java acceleration. |
 |
On-chip ROM and SRAM memory devices, including a 3-Mbit
frame buffer. |
 |
Security framework for enhanced mobile
security, including stronger DRM. |
 |
Multichannel DMA controller for efficient data transfer
without CPU intervention. |
 |
A multi-layer AMBA crossbar interconnect for optimized
data transfers between the CPU, accelerators, memory
devices and peripherals. |
 |
Hardware semaphores for flexible inter-process management. |
 |
A wide range of peripheral interfaces (GPIO, USB-OTG
high speed, UART, I²C, FIrDA, SD/SDIO/high-speed
MMC/Memory Stick Pro, fast serial ports, TV output,
color LCD and camera interfaces, scroll-key encoder,
key-pad scanner). |
 |
Direct support for high-level operating system such
as Symbian™, Linux and Window Mobile WinCE® operating systems
(OSs). |

The convergence of computing, multimedia and mobile communications
is well underway. Already the familiar voice phone is being
transformed into a personal device with a wide range of
multimedia capabilities. Soon mobile users will be able
to benefit from a broad spectrum of multimedia features
and services, to include capturing, sending and receiving
images, videos and music.
To deliver such data-heavy, processing-intensive services,
portable handheld systems must be optimized for high performance
but low power, space and cost. In response to this need,
the STn8815 processor platform from STMicroelectronics is
a culmination of breakthroughs in video coding efficiency,
inventive algorithms and chip implementation schemes. It
will enable smart phones, wireless PDAs, internet appliances
and car entertainment systems to play back media content,
record pictures and video clips, and perform bidirectional
audio-visual communication with other systems in real time.
The STn8815 focuses on the essential features to meet
the future needs of mobile products and services: a high-performance
multimedia capability coupled with low power consumption,
and based on an open platform strategy. |
